Cavalleria Rusticana (1987 - Remaster): O Lola ch'hai di lattl la cammisa (Turiddu) is a song by Pietro Mascagni, released on 1979. It is track number 2 in the album Mascagni: Cavalleria Rusticana/Leoncavallo: I Pagliacci. Cavalleria Rusticana (1987 - Remaster): O Lola ch'hai di lattl la cammisa (Turiddu) has a BPM/tempo of 96 beats per minute, is in the key of F min and has a duration of 2 minutes, 10 seconds.

Cavalleria Rusticana (1987 - Remaster): O Lola ch'hai di lattl la cammisa (Turiddu) is fairly popular on Spotify. It is beginning to gain traction, being rated between 10-30% popularity on Spotify. It is likely that the track is on the verge of getting onto Spotify owned playlists, is not very energetic, being quite a low energy/chill track and is most likely not the easiest thing to dance to, probably being a bit more of a relaxed song.
